Water Heater Replacement Questions
When should a water heater be replaced? Replacement is recommended when the unit shows signs of frequent breakdowns, reduced efficiency, or has reached its expected lifespan.
What types of water heaters are available for replacement? Options include tank-style, tankless, and hybrid models, each suited to different household needs and space considerations.
How can property owners determine the right size for a new water heater? The appropriate size depends on household water usage, number of occupants, and peak demand times.
What are common signs indicating a water heater needs replacement? Signs include inconsistent hot water, leaks, strange noises, or a significant increase in energy bills.
